TWO TRUCKS CRASH ON N1!

TWO trucks collided on the N1 South before Allandale Road just after New Road in Midrand on Monday afternoon.

Motorists were advised not to used the N1 South on after the serious truck accident.

It's alleged that the truck crashed into a Roads Agency truck and pushed it off the road and into a large road sign.

Advanced Life Support paramedics attended to the two male drivers.

Both had sustained moderate injuries, they were then stabilised at the scene before being transported to hospital for further assessment and care.

Traffic towards Allandale was backed up, as motorists were rerouting from the crash on the R101 Southbound.

Four lanes were closed-off by traffic officials.
